Before cutover, confirm that Pairwright's matching service no longer exhibits garbage-collection pauses exceeding 200ms under load. These pauses previously caused match-request timeouts that were retried without idempotency keys, a behavior flagged in the prior audit. Run the soak test harness for 30 minutes and inspect the `gc_pause_histogram` metric. Verify that retry storms no longer produce duplicate match rows by querying the audit table directly. Connect to the staging replica using the connection string below.

replica DSN, yahaf-yagaf: mongodb://tamath_svc:a2netSk3RZMuTj@db-d084.novacsoft.internal:5432/ralmir

## Formula sandbox tuning

User-supplied formulas in Gridmoor execute inside a restricted interpreter with hard ceilings on time, memory, and call depth. Reviewers should confirm any change to these ceilings is justified in the PR description, since raising them widens the abuse surface. Defaults were chosen from production traces. The current limits are as follows.

limits module of tafog-fawip:
WEIGHTS = {
    "julix": 57,
    "lamys": 992,
    "kasvan": 209,
    "quenok": 750,
    "alddor": 259,
    "oliath": 1009,
    "wenix": 815,
}

- [ ] **Step 7: Breaker override escrow.** After sealing the signing keys for the Tallgrove upstream API circuit breaker, confirm the support team can force the breaker open during a full outage. The override bundle lives in the sealed escrow drawer and is useless without its unlock phrase. Two ceremony witnesses must initial this step before proceeding. The escrow bundle is decrypted with the recovery passphrase that follows.

vault phrase of kahip-kahop = holath-quenmir